Position Summary

EPIC Health is seeking an experienced Healthcare Clinical Administrator (APP Leadership Role) to oversee the operational performance of our primary care and integrated care clinics.

This is a hybrid clinical-administrative leadership role designed for an experienced Advanced Practice Provider (FNP, PA) who has transitioned into operational leadership.

While clinical knowledge is essential, this role is primarily focused on clinic operations, practice management, team leadership, and performance improvement, rather than direct patient care.

The ideal candidate understands both sides of healthcare delivery—clinical workflows and operational systems—and can bridge the gap between providers, staff, and executive leadership to drive high-quality, efficient care.


What You’ll DoClinical Operations & Practice Management
  • Oversee day-to-day clinic operations to ensure efficient patient flow and consistent care delivery
  • Optimize scheduling, staffing, and provider utilization
  • Support implementation of clinical workflows, protocols, and operational standards
  • Ensure smooth coordination between providers, nursing staff, and administrative teams
Leadership & Team Development
  • Lead and support clinical and administrative staff across assigned locations
  • Drive accountability, performance management, and team development
  • Assist with onboarding, training, and coaching of staff
  • Promote a culture of collaboration, efficiency, and patient-centered care
Quality & Patient Experience
  • Monitor quality metrics, patient satisfaction, and operational KPIs
  • Identify gaps in workflows and implement improvements
  • Support compliance with clinical standards, safety protocols, and regulatory requirements
  • Partner with leadership to enhance patient experience and care consistency
Cross-Functional Collaboration
  • Act as a liaison between clinical teams and operational leadership
  • Partner with HR, billing, operations, and specialty teams to support clinic success
  • Assist in rollout of new programs, initiatives, and workflow changes
Operational Improvement
  • Identify inefficiencies and support process redesign initiatives
  • Use reporting and data insights to support decision-making
  • Help standardize workflows across multiple clinic locations

What You BringRequired Qualifications
  • Active licensure as an FNP or PA
  • Minimum 3 years of clinical experience, with 2 years in leadership, administrative, or operational roles
  • Strong understanding of outpatient primary care or integrated care environments
  • Proven experience managing teams, workflows, or clinic operations
  • Strong communication, leadership, and organizational skills
Preferred Qualifications
  • Prior experience as a Practice Manager, Clinical Lead, or Operations Manager
  • Experience in value-based care, population health, or multi-site healthcare operations
  • Familiarity with EHR systems (Athena preferred)
  • Lean, Six Sigma, or process improvement experience a plus
  • Experience transitioning from clinical practice into administrative leadership
